Salome HOME
except et print
[tools/eficas.git] / InterfaceQT4 / monWidgetFormule.py
index 7c6fbcbe811ae22a977debabdb62dda715c0b1e5..e225b478fa54771c9567c81571d50eaac3d2695d 100644 (file)
@@ -56,13 +56,16 @@ class MonWidgetFormule(QWidget,Ui_WidgetFormule,FacultatifOuOptionnel):
  
       self.setIconePoubelle()
       self.setIconesGenerales()
+      self.setValeurs()
       self.setValide()
 
      
       if monEnvQT5 :
+         #if self.editor.code in ['MAP','CARMELCND','CF'] : self.bCatalogue.close()
          if self.editor.code in ['MAP','CARMELCND'] : self.bCatalogue.close()
          else : self.bCatalogue.clicked.connect(self.afficheCatalogue)
-         if self.editor.code in ['Adao','MAP'] : 
+         #if self.editor.code in ['Adao','MAP','CF'] : 
+         if self.editor.code in ['Adao','MAP','ADAO'] : 
                self.bAvant.close()
                self.bApres.close()
          else : 
@@ -98,6 +101,16 @@ class MonWidgetFormule(QWidget,Ui_WidgetFormule,FacultatifOuOptionnel):
       self.listeAffichageWidget[0].setFocus(7)
 
 
+  def setValeurs(self):
+        self.LENomFormule.setText(self.node.item.get_nom())
+        self.LECorpsFormule.setText(self.node.item.get_corps())
+        texte_args=""
+        if self.node.item.get_args() != None :
+            for i in self.node.item.get_args() :
+                if texte_args != "" : texte_args = texte_args +","
+                texte_args=texte_args + i
+        self.LENomsArgs.setText(texte_args)
+
 
   def nomChange(self):
       nom = str(self.LENom.text())